## Red Flags

- Tabs or lines >132 characters
- Missing `intent` on dummy arguments
- Blanket `use module` without `only`
- No `implicit none`
- Default-public module exporting everything
- `real*8` or implicit typing
- Obsolescent Fortran (`common`, `goto`, arithmetic `if`)
- `dimension(:), allocatable` when `name(:)` suffices
- Wrong stride hot loops (`A(i,:,:)`)
- Magic floats without `_dp`
- Public symbols without FORD docs
- Multiple modules in one file
- Trailing whitespace

## Verification

- `fprettify --diff` / project formatter check
- `ford` documentation build (if project uses FORD)
- `gfortran -std=f2008 -Wall` (or project flags) on changed sources
- `ctest` / project test runner
